import {MIN_UNICODE, MAX_UNICODE} from "./common";
import {Store} from "../Store";
function encodeKey(roomId: string, targetEventId: string, relType: string, sourceEventId: string): string {
return `${roomId}|${targetEventId}|${relType}|${sourceEventId}`;
}
interface RelationEntry {
roomId: string;
targetEventId: string;
sourceEventId: string;
relType: string;
}
function decodeKey(key: string): RelationEntry {
const [roomId, targetEventId, relType, sourceEventId] = key.split("|");
return {roomId, targetEventId, relType, sourceEventId};
}
export class TimelineRelationStore {
private _store: Store<{ key: string }>;
constructor(store: Store<{ key: string }>) {
this._store = store;
}
add(roomId: string, targetEventId: string, relType: string, sourceEventId: string): void {
this._store.add({key: encodeKey(roomId, targetEventId, relType, sourceEventId)});
}
remove(roomId: string, targetEventId: string, relType: string, sourceEventId: string): void {
this._store.delete(encodeKey(roomId, targetEventId, relType, sourceEventId));
}
removeAllForTarget(roomId: string, targetId: string): void {
const range = this._store.IDBKeyRange.bound(
encodeKey(roomId, targetId, MIN_UNICODE, MIN_UNICODE),
encodeKey(roomId, targetId, MAX_UNICODE, MAX_UNICODE),
true,
true
);
this._store.delete(range);
}
removeAllForRoom(roomId: string) {
const range = this._store.IDBKeyRange.bound(
encodeKey(roomId, MIN_UNICODE, MIN_UNICODE, MIN_UNICODE),
encodeKey(roomId, MAX_UNICODE, MAX_UNICODE, MAX_UNICODE),
true,
true
);
this._store.delete(range);
}
async getForTargetAndType(roomId: string, targetId: string, relType: string): Promise<RelationEntry[]> {
// exclude both keys as they are theoretical min and max,
// but we should't have a match for just the room id, or room id with max
const range = this._store.IDBKeyRange.bound(
encodeKey(roomId, targetId, relType, MIN_UNICODE),
encodeKey(roomId, targetId, relType, MAX_UNICODE),
true,
true
);
const items = await this._store.selectAll(range);
return items.map(i => decodeKey(i.key));
}
async getAllForTarget(roomId: string, targetId: string): Promise<RelationEntry[]> {
// exclude both keys as they are theoretical min and max,
// but we should't have a match for just the room id, or room id with max
const range = this._store.IDBKeyRange.bound(
encodeKey(roomId, targetId, MIN_UNICODE, MIN_UNICODE),
encodeKey(roomId, targetId, MAX_UNICODE, MAX_UNICODE),
true,
true
);
const items = await this._store.selectAll(range);
return items.map(i => decodeKey(i.key));
}
}
